## Break-Glass Access: Lumenkit Component Library

Welcome aboard! Lumenkit is our shared UI library, and its versioning is strict semver — no exceptions. If a broken minor release blocks every downstream team and the release bot is down, you can use break-glass access to push a hotfix tag directly.

Only do this if both maintainers (currently Priya and Oskar on the Fennelworks platform team) are unreachable. Break-glass pushes are audited weekly.

To unlock the emergency publishing vault, use the recovery passphrase below.

unlock words, yawig-kagef: gordor-holvan-ulaael-pramir-ulaiel-tamdor

- [ ] Step 7: Archive cold storage buckets (Glacierline tier). Confirm both ceremony witnesses are present, verify bucket manifests match the Oxbow ledger, then seal the archive key shares. Plugin authors may observe but not handle shares. Once sealed, the archive index itself is encrypted and can only be reopened with the passphrase below.

vault phrase of badup-hahig = tamael-aldael-kelmir-istael-fenok-istwyn-tamius-jorath-oliion

# Env Vars — Bouncecourt

Bouncecourt processes bounce notifications from the Mailwren relay. Required vars: `BOUNCE_QUEUE_NAME`, `RETRY_LIMIT`, `SUPPRESS_LIST_TTL`. Defaults live in `env.defaults`; never edit that file directly. Local overrides go in `.env`, which is gitignored. The processor won't authenticate to the relay without its credential, so before first run add this line to `.env`:

sealed setting: ARCHIVE_KEY3=8d0

// REINDEX_BATCH_CAP limits docs per shard pass in the Tallowfield
// nightly search reindex. Raising it starves the ingest queue;
// lowering it overruns the maintenance window. 5000 is the tested
// sweet spot. Change only with a soak run. Verified against the
// build noted below.

session token of bawif-hahog = htk6_ac5981